اليك أهم أوامر الطرفية الأساسية والمتقدمة لتوزيعات أوبونتو ومشتقاتها

الكاتب: بوشعيب حيموشتاريخ النشر: آخر تحديث: وقت القراءة:
للقراءة
عدد الكلمات:
كلمة
عدد التعليقات: 0 تعليق
نبذة عن المقال: أوامر الطرفية الأساسية والمتقدمة في توزيعات أوبونتو ومشتقاتها. تعلم كيفية إدارة البرامج، الملفات، الشبكة، وتحليل الأداء بكفاءة وسهولة

دليل شامل لأوامر الطرفية الأساسية والمتقدمة في توزيعات أوبونتو ومشتقاتها

تُعتبر توزيعات أوبونتو (Ubuntu) ومشتقاتها، مثل لينكس مينت وإليمنتري OS، من أكثر توزيعات لينكس شهرة. تجمع هذه التوزيعات بين السهولة في الاستخدام والقوة في الأداء، مما يجعلها مثالية للمبتدئين والمحترفين. تعتمد هذه التوزيعات على مدير الحزم APT لإدارة التطبيقات والتحديثات، مما يتيح مرونة في التعامل مع النظام باستخدام الطرفية.

اليك أهم أوامر الطرفية الأساسية والمتقدمة لتوزيعات أوبونتو ومشتقاتها
اليك أهم أوامر الطرفية الأساسية والمتقدمة لتوزيعات أوبونتو ومشتقاتها

إذا كنت من محبي أنظمة التشغيل مفتوحة المصدر مثل أوبونتو ومشتقاتها، فأنت بالتأكيد تعرف أهمية الطرفية (Terminal) في تحسين كفاءتك ومرونتك أثناء العمل على هذه الأنظمة. الطرفية ليست مجرد نافذة سوداء مليئة بالأوامر، بل هي أداة قوية تُمكنك من التحكم الكامل بالنظام، من تثبيت البرامج إلى إدارة الشبكات .

 في هذا الدليل الشامل، على مدونة ياسمين للمعلوميات سنستعرض بعض أوامر الطرفية الأساسية للمبتدئين، وصولاً إلى الأوامر المتقدمة التي يحتاجها المحترفون. سواء كنت تخطو أولى خطواتك في عالم لينكس أو تبحث عن تحسين إنتاجيتك، ستجد هنا كل ما تحتاج.

1. أوامر الطرفية الأساسية للمبتدئين

تعتمد الأوامر الأساسية على تسهيل إدارة البرامج والنظام دون الحاجة إلى واجهة رسومية. هذه الأوامر مناسبة للقيام بالمهام اليومية مثل التثبيت، الإزالة، وتحديث النظام.

1.1 فتح الطرفية
كيفية الوصول:
للوصول إلى الطرفية، اضغط على:
Ctrl + Alt + T
1.2 تثبيت البرامج
الغرض: تثبيت البرامج بسهولة باستخدام اسم الحزمة.
الأمر:
HTML
sudo apt-get install <package_name>
مثال:
لتثبيت برنامج VLC:
sudo apt-get install vlc
1.3 إزالة البرامج
الغرض: إزالة البرامج غير المرغوب فيها.
الأمر:
HTML
sudo apt-get remove <package_name>
مثال:
لإزالة VLC:
sudo apt-get remove vlc
1.4 تنظيف النظام
الغرض: إزالة الملفات المؤقتة والحزم غير الضرورية.
الأوامر:
HTML
sudo apt-get clean sudo apt-get autoclean
1.5 تحديث النظام
الغرض: تحديث قائمة الحزم المثبتة إلى أحدث إصدار.
الأمر:
HTML
sudo apt-get update

2. أوامر الطرفية المتقدمة للمحترفين

تمكّنك الأوامر المتقدمة من تنفيذ عمليات معقدة مثل إدارة المستودعات، إصلاح الحزم، وترقية النظام.

2.1 ترقية النظام بالكامل

الغرض: تحديث جميع الحزم المثبتة إلى الإصدارات الأحدث.
الأمر:
HTML
sudo apt-get upgrade

2.2 إزالة الحزم مع إعداداتها
الغرض: إزالة الحزم بما في ذلك ملفات التهيئة الخاصة بها.
الأمر:
HTML
sudo apt-get purge <package_name>
لإزالة الحزم غير المستخدمة مع الإعدادات:
HTML
sudo apt-get autoremove --purge
2.3 إصلاح الحزم المكسورة
الغرض: حل مشكلات الحزم غير المثبتة أو المكسورة.
الأوامر:
HTML
sudo dpkg --configure -a sudo apt-get install -f
2.4 إدارة المستودعات
إضافة مستودع جديد:
HTML
sudo add-apt-repository ppa:<repository_name>

تحديث قائمة المستودعات:

HTML
sudo apt-get update



3. أوامر إدارة الملفات والدلائل

تتيح لك هذه الأوامر إدارة الملفات والمجلدات بكفاءة.
3.1 عرض الملفات والمجلدات
الأمر:ls -l
يعرض قائمة تفصيلية بجميع الملفات والمجلدات.
3.2 إنشاء مجلد جديد
الأمر:
HTML
mkdir <directory_name>

3.3 حذف الملفات والمجلدات
الأمر:
HTML
rm -r <directory_name>

كن حذرًا عند استخدام هذا الأمر، لأنه يحذف الملفات نهائيًا.
3.4 البحث عن ملف معين
الأمر:
HTML
find . -name "filename"

3.5 نسخ الملفات والمجلدات
الأمر:
HTML
cp <source> <destination>

4. أوامر الشبكة عل توزيعة اوبونتو

4.1 اختبار الاتصال بالخادم
الأمر:
HTML
ping <hostname>
4.2 عرض إعدادات الشبكة
للأنظمة القديمة:
ifconfig
للأنظمة الحديثة:
ip a
4.3 الاتصال بجهاز آخر عبر SSH
الأمر:
HTML
ssh <username>@<hostname>

5. مراقبة العمليات والنظام على لينكس

5.1 مراقبة العمليات الجارية
الأمر:
top
يعرض العمليات النشطة واستهلاك الموارد مثل المعالج والذاكرة.
استعمالات الامر top على لينكس
 أهم أوامر الطرفية الأساسية والمتقدمة لتوزيعات أوبونتو ومشتقاتها
5.2 أداة HTOP المتقدمة
الأمر لتثبيتها:
HTML
sudo apt-get install htop
تشغيلها:
htop

6. أوامر النظام الإضافية

6.1 عرض استخدام القرص
الأمر:
df -h
يعرض المساحة المستخدمة والمتاحة في الأقراص.
6.2 عرض استخدام الذاكرة
الأمر:
free -m
يعرض الذاكرة المتاحة والمستخدمة بالنظام.
6.3 الحصول على معلومات النظام
الأمر:
uname -a

نصائح هامة

احرص دائمًا على النسخ الاحتياطي:
قبل استخدام أي أوامر قد تؤدي إلى حذف أو تعديل الملفات.
استخدام man للحصول على المساعدة:
لمعرفة المزيد عن أي أمر، استخدم:
man <command>

في توزيعات أوبونتو ومعظم أنظمة لينكس، يمكنك استخدام الأمر man للحصول على المساعدة والاستفهام عن تفاصيل أي أمر آخر.

صيغة الأمر:
HTML
man <command>

مثال:
إذا أردت معرفة تفاصيل عن الأمر ls: man ls
ما الذي يوفره هذا الأمر؟
  • شرح تفصيلي عن استخدام الأمر.
  • الخيارات (Options) المتاحة للأمر.
أمثلة على كيفية استخدامه.
طريقة أخرى للحصول على المساعدة:
📌يمكنك استخدام خيار --help مع معظم الأوامر:
<command> --help
مثال:
ls --help
  • سيعرض هذا قائمة مختصرة بالخيارات والوظائف المتوفرة مع الأمر.
  • استخدم man للحصول على دليل شامل عن أي أمر.
  • استخدم --help للحصول على مساعدة مختصرة وسريعة.

إن إتقان استخدام الطرفية في توزيعات أوبونتو ومشتقاتها ليس مجرد مهارة تقنية بل هو خطوة نحو التميز في عالم أنظمة التشغيل مفتوحة المصدر. باستخدام هذا الدليل، يمكنك تنفيذ المهام اليومية بمرونة، وحل المشكلات بفعالية، وتعزيز إنتاجيتك بشكل ملحوظ.

لا تتردد في تطبيق هذه الأوامر يوميًا، واستكشاف إمكانياتها. ومع الوقت، ستكتشف أن الطرفية ليست مجرد أداة بل هي شريك موثوق يفتح أمامك آفاقًا جديدة في إدارة الأنظمة.

 تذكر أن التعلم المستمر والتطبيق العملي هما مفتاح احتراف استخدام لينكس. ابدأ اليوم، وكن جزءًا من مجتمع عالمي من المبدعين والمطورين الذين يقدرون قوة الطرفية.

شارك المقال لتنفع به غيرك

قد تُعجبك هذه المشاركات

إرسال تعليق

ليست هناك تعليقات

949521816451048775

العلامات المرجعية

قائمة العلامات المرجعية فارغة ... قم بإضافة مقالاتك الآن

    البحث